Ulik is a fictional character that appears in the Marvel Universe. Ulik is an Asgardian troll, a perennial foe of the Thunder God Thor and first appeared in Thor (1st series) #137.
[edit] Fictional character biography
Ulik belongs to a race of Rock Trolls who live in the dimension of Asgard. Like all trolls, he has an innate hatred of the Asgardians as they were driven underground by Odin and forbidden to live on the surface. For some unknown reason, Ulik is vastly superior to other Rock Trolls in terms of strength; durability and fighting ability, making him a natural opponent for Thor. Ulik first encounters Thor when commanded by the Rock Troll King, Geirrodur, to steal Thor's enchanted uru hammer, Mjolnir. [1] While Ulik failed, he has returned on several occasions, and has at times aided Thor against a common enemy. Ulik is also responsible for accidentally awakening Mangog. [2]
